Overview
The ISO7731DBQR is a high-performance, triple-channel digital isolator manufactured by Texas Instruments. Designed for applications requiring robust isolation, this component ensures reliable signal transmission across isolated barriers. It is particularly suited for industrial automation, automotive electronics, and other high-noise environments. The ISO7731DBQR stands out for its high electromagnetic immunity, low power consumption, and compliance with international safety standards such as UL, VDE, CSA, TUV, and CQC.
Key Specifications
Parameter | Value | Unit | Notes |
---|---|---|---|
Isolation Rating | 5000, 3000 | V RMS | DW and DBQ packages respectively |
Number of Channels | 3 | # | |
Data Rate (Max) | 100 | Mbps | |
Propagation Delay (Typ) | 10.7 | ns | |
Current Consumption per Channel (1 Mbps) | 1.53 | mA | |
Operating Temperature Range | -55 to 125 | °C | |
Package | SSOP-16 | ||
Surge Voltage Capability | 12800, 6400 | Vpk |
Key Features
- High-speed, robust EMC performance for reliable signal isolation.
- Low power consumption, ideal for energy-efficient designs.
- Compliance with international safety standards (UL, VDE, CSA, TUV, CQC).
- High electromagnetic immunity ensures stable operation in noisy environments.
- Enable pins for multi-master driving applications and reduced power consumption.
Applications
The ISO7731DBQR is widely used in various industries, including:
- Industrial Automation: Ensures reliable communication between control systems and sensors in high-noise environments.
- Automotive Electronics: Provides isolation for CAN bus and other communication interfaces in vehicles.
- Medical Equipment: Safeguards sensitive electronics from high-voltage circuits in medical devices.
- Power Supplies: Isolates control circuits from power stages in switch-mode power supplies.
